What Is Cloud SaaS?
Cloud SaaS (Software-as-a-Service) delivers applications via the internet on a subscription basis. Instead of installing software locally, businesses access platforms hosted in cloud data centers managed by providers such as:
- Salesforce
- Microsoft (via Dynamics 365 & Microsoft 365)
- Oracle
- SAP
Key characteristics:
- Subscription-based pricing (OpEx model)
- Automatic updates
- Cloud infrastructure managed by vendor
- Accessible from anywhere
What Is On-Premise Software?
On-premise software is installed and hosted on company-owned servers within local data centers. Organizations manage:
- Hardware infrastructure
- Maintenance and upgrades
- Security configurations
- Backup and disaster recovery
It follows a CapEx-heavy model, requiring upfront licensing and hardware investments.
Comparing Cloud SaaS vs On-Premise: Cost Structure Breakdown
1️⃣ Upfront Investment
Cloud SaaS
- Minimal upfront costs
- Subscription-based
- No hardware purchase
On-Premise
- High licensing fees
- Server hardware costs
- Data center infrastructure
- Implementation services
Winner: Cloud SaaS (Lower Initial Barrier)
2️⃣ Total Cost of Ownership (TCO)
When analyzing long-term TCO (5–7 years), consider:
On-Premise TCO Includes:
- Hardware refresh cycles (every 3–5 years)
- IT staffing costs
- Power and cooling
- Maintenance contracts
- Security investments
- Upgrade projects
Cloud SaaS TCO Includes:
- Recurring subscription fees
- Integration costs
- Data migration
- Premium support tiers
Realistic 5-Year Outlook
| Cost Factor | Cloud SaaS | On-Premise |
|---|---|---|
| Infrastructure | Included | High |
| Maintenance | Included | Ongoing |
| IT Staff | Lower | Higher |
| Upgrade Costs | Automatic | Expensive projects |
| Scalability | Elastic | Hardware dependent |
Most mid-sized enterprises see 15–30% lower TCO with SaaS over five years — particularly when factoring staffing and upgrade costs.

Security & Compliance Considerations
Security is often cited as a reason to stay on-premise. But the reality has shifted.
Major SaaS providers invest billions annually in:
- SOC 2 compliance
- ISO 27001 certifications
- Advanced encryption
- 24/7 security monitoring
- AI-driven threat detection
In many cases, SaaS vendors offer stronger security infrastructure than mid-market businesses can maintain internally.
On-premise may offer more control — but also greater internal responsibility and risk.
Security ROI Winner (for most mid-market firms): Cloud SaaS

Vendor Lock-In & Risk Considerations
Cloud SaaS Risks
- Subscription dependency
- Price increases
- Vendor roadmap control
On-Premise Risks
- Obsolete hardware
- Cybersecurity vulnerabilities
- High capital sunk cost
Both models involve risk — but SaaS risk can often be mitigated via strong contracts and multi-vendor strategy.

When On-Premise Might Deliver Better ROI
On-premise may be justified when:
- Extremely strict data sovereignty laws apply
- Legacy systems cannot migrate
- Predictable workloads at massive scale
- Internal IT teams are highly mature
However, these cases are increasingly niche in 2026.
